Tax Optimization Strategies for Multinational Enterprises

In today’s globalized economy, multinational enterprises (MNEs) face complex tax environments across various jurisdictions. Effective tax optimization strategies are essential for minimizing liabilities and maximizing profits while ensuring compliance with diverse international regulations. Here are key strategies MNEs can adopt to optimize their tax positions globally.
1. Transfer Pricing
Transfer pricing involves setting prices for goods, services, and intangibles exchanged between related entities in different countries. It is crucial for MNEs to align their transfer pricing practices with the arm’s length principle, ensuring transactions reflect market value. Proper management of transfer pricing can help allocate profits to jurisdictions with lower tax rates, thereby reducing overall tax liabilities.
2. Leveraging Tax Treaties
Tax treaties between countries are designed to prevent double taxation and facilitate cross-border trade. By understanding and utilizing these treaties, businesses can minimize withholding taxes on dividends, interest, and royalties. This strategic use of tax treaties allows companies to optimize their global tax position, ensuring they are not taxed multiple times on the same income.
3. Profit Repatriation
Strategic planning for profit repatriation is essential for minimizing taxes on profits earned abroad. By utilizing lower-tax jurisdictions or taking advantage of exemptions in domestic tax laws, businesses can defer or reduce repatriation taxes. Careful planning of when and how to bring foreign earnings home is crucial for optimizing tax outcomes.
4. Holding Company Structures
Establishing a holding company in a jurisdiction with favorable tax laws is a common strategy for global tax optimization. Holding companies can benefit from reduced corporate taxes, favorable tax treaties, and efficient profit repatriation. This structure helps MNEs reduce their global tax exposure and improve operational efficiency.
5. Embracing Technology and Data Analytics
The use of technology and data analytics has revolutionized tax optimization strategies for multinational corporations. Sophisticated software tools enable efficient tax management by aligning with international tax laws and regulations. This technological advancement helps businesses lower their tax bills while ensuring compliance.
By implementing these strategies, multinational enterprises can effectively manage their tax liabilities, enhance profitability, and maintain competitiveness in the global market. As international tax landscapes continue to evolve, staying informed and proactive in adopting these strategies is essential for long-term success.
